A neighbourhood in Borinage found itself locked up this Thursday morning, following a threat to a locked-in vehicle. Police, firefighters and demining services converged towards the area, while the inhabitants remained locked up in their homes. Several streets were cut off from traffic and a wide security perimeter was set up. Against the background, an explosive warning linked to a car recently seized for debt took place.
